About This Item

Oregon: Klamath County Museum, 1988. Unknown. Very Good. Signed and inscribed by the author on the title page, "To Susan and David, Best wishes and good reading, Francis S. Landrum 19 August 1988." A very good copy of this trade paperback, clean and tight in a solid binding. Bending at the corners, and light shelf-wear to the edges. 137 pp., filled with black and white photos, newspaper reports and correspondence.
